Transaction 25579150c78055c98d1b9f0e8c341ca28e3b378965494b702b599b3426b5a292
1 Input
1 Output
-
25579150c78055c98d1b9f0e8c341ca28e3b378965494b702b599b3426b5a292:0
- value
- 152489
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ddcad1d3adace16646dc9f5a2a98d6d3e8b0b708
- address
- bc1qmh9dr5ad4nskv3kunadz4xxk605tpdcgwn6y07